Abstract

During weed surveys in irrigated crops in the Kenitra province of Morocco in 2024 and 2025, we found three new Poaceae weeds: Dinebra panicea subsp. mucronata, Diplachne fusca subsp. fascicularis, and Oryza punctata. At present, the three semi-aquatic taxa are naturalized and adapted to water-saturated conditions prevailing in rice and sugarcane fields. To facilitate their identification, this note provides a brief morphological description of each taxon, photographs, a distribution map, and data on ecology and habitats. These taxa are considered new alien records for the flora of Morocco.
